From the 20th to the 21st Century
Panagiotis Kondylis exposes the messy power struggles lurking beneath the polished surface of liberal democracy as the world shifts from the 20th to the 21st century. The collapse of old ideologies didn’t clear the stage but revealed new contradictions and instabilities dressed up as progress. What really drives political change is less idealism and more raw, often ruthless, power.
